About this job

The Regional Human Resources Generalist will assist and support management with handling various Human Resources activities.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to monitoring and assisting with hiring events, fielding and responding to team member relations complaints, conducting investigations, and training new team members on HR processes, programs and policies, ensuring compliance with all local, state and federal laws. This position will report directly to the Sr. Regional HR Manager.

Essential Functions

-·         Responsible for guidance to all team members to ensure consistent adherence to HR policies, procedures and practices

  • Recruiting: Sourcing talent and building a network of potential candidates from different markets
  • Training and Development: Coordinate, facilitate and/or assist in all training activities within assigned region
  • Assist SRHRM in the development and implementation of all strategic HR management and company initiatives
  • Employee Relations: Works in partnership with SRHRM to address Team Member relations issues, including harassment allegations, work conditions, etc.
  • Fosters a positive work environment that supports Open Door and pro-active team member relations through company engagement surveys and individual store climate surveys
  • Provide internal management consultation to promote a harmonious working environment with all departments to build effective relationships within the company
  • Ensures compliance with all federal, state and local employment/labor laws
  • Routinely conducts compliance audits to ensure appropriate practices are adhered to and are consistent from location to location
  • Support New Store Openings and conducts new hire orientations as needed
  • Support Talent Acquisition department planning hiring event in existing stores/markets, interviewing candidates and make hiring recommendations when appropriate
  • Partnership with Support Office Key Business Partners; Benefits, Talent Acquisition, Human Resources
  • Administrative support in reviewing and processing terminations, new hire and promotion pay change paperwork
  • Performs other related duties and participates in special projects as assigned
  • Ability to travel regularly to stores within Northern Colorado, Utah and Oklahoma markets and occasional travel to other regions may be requested
